DFS adverts banned

Wed Dec 03 11:56AM

Three DFS television adverts have been banned - not because they are annoying but because the sofas featured in the adverts were made to look bigger than they actually are.

The ads, which featured people miming to the Nickelback song ‘Rockstar', were declared misleading by the Advertising Standards Authority because the footage of actors singing was superimposed onto shots of sofas, making the furniture seem bigger than it was.

The watchdog, which received 21 complaints, said: "We considered that the production technique used in the ad meant that some of the sofas did appear large in relation to the actors. Because DFS had not been able to demonstrate that the sofas featured in the ad were accurate reflections of the actual sofas, we concluded that the ad was misleading."

DFS argued that customers visited their stores to examine items such as sofas before they bought them, and that any exaggeration in size would have caused widespread disappointment and large numbers of complaints to Trading Standards, which had not been the case.

The three advertising codes breached by the DFS campaign were that adverts must not mislead the public, that they must not imply qualities beyond those normally provided, and that they must not use visual techniques or special effects to mislead.
